Beaulieu Canada is a North American leader in the manufacturing and distribution of floor coverings. For over 65 years, we have been developing, manufacturing and selling quality products such as carpet, luxury vinyl, laminate and engineered wood flooring.

Your dream job

Being a major player 

  • Prioritizing and planning work orders in collaboration with internal customers and maintenance and project managers.
  • Scheduling routine, major and emergency preventive inspections and repairs of production equipment.
  • Scheduling of work to be performed by subcontractors.
  • Develop and update equipment inspection and preventive maintenance routes.
  • Perform major shutdown planning.
  • Effectively communicate weekly and monthly maintenance plans to various stakeholders and internal customers.
  • Represent the maintenance department at daily production meetings and take action on issues raised.
  • Contact suppliers and stakeholders to propose solutions to spontaneous problems related to equipment or building maintenance.
  • Propose, implement and document innovative solutions to reliability, equipment safety and product quality issues following failure analyses performed in team.
  • Occasionally, draw mechanical parts that need to be manufactured in a hurry.
  • Contribute expertise and actively participate in the standardization of work methods.
